Autumn Yam and Peanut Soup

ingredients
- 1 teaspoon oil
- 1 cup onion, chopped
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1 lb yam, peeled and cut into chunks
- 1 large green apple, peeled and cut into chunks
- 1 (14 1/2 ounce) can chicken broth
- 1 (6 ounce) can apple juice
- 1⁄8 teaspoon cinnamon
- salt and pepper
- 1⁄2 cup creamy peanut butter
directions
- In large saucepan over medium heat, heat oil. Add onions and cumin. Cook until onion is translucent, stirring occasionally.
- Add yams, apple, broth, apple juice, cinnamon, and salt and pepper to taste. Cover and b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er for 20 minutes, or until apples are tender. Add peanut butter. Stir until melted.
- Ladle into blender in batches if nessesary and blender until smooth. Return to pan. Heat through.
- To serve, ladle into bowls. Garnish with sour cream, chopped peanuts, and apple slices, if desired.
